Rebels say they aren't taking the Gators lightly: Jim McElwain said in his Monday press conference that Ole Miss probably "figures they should beat the heck out of us" and likely "doesn't have much regard for us." Mississippi coach Hugh Freeze and quarterback Chad Kelly disagreed. The Rebels say they don't want to make a mistake by taking the Gators lightly after a week of low-energy practice led to a sluggish performance against Vanderbilt. (Daniel Paulding, The Clarion-Ledger)
